Subject: Handover — FleetBurn fuel report release

Taking PTO Thursday. FleetBurn v3.2 fuel-usage report ships Friday to the Halvorsen Logistics tenant. Pipeline is green; only the diesel-variance chart changed. If the nightly aggregation stalls, rerun the rollup job and re-trigger staging. Don't touch the Vantrell cluster config. Sign the final artifact before promotion using the key below.

deploy key for kajof-fajop: bky6_gDHw9Q

Action item (postmortem PM-7, VaultSpin rotation outage)

Reviewer: confirm the new dry-run flag in VaultSpin refuses to write rotated secrets when the backing store is degraded. Check the retry path too — the old code looped forever on a 503. Tests must cover partial-rotation rollback. Acceptance criteria and the rollback design note live on the internal page here.

operations page: https://jenkins.zemvarcloud.local/job/merge_requests/repo/build/73930b4b30f0a8ed

## Releases

ShelfStream publishes catalogue-import builds monthly. Plugin authors must target the import schema pinned in each release tag; MARC-variant mappings change between minors, so re-run the Stackwise conformance suite before publishing. Unsigned plugin bundles are rejected by the registry. All official ShelfStream artifacts are signed; verify downloads before building against them using the key below.

release key, yafof-kadup: bky4_soBk

## Sensor drift: what to do at 3am

If the GrowLoop controller starts reporting humidity swings that don't match the backup probes in the Fernwick greenhouse, it's almost always sensor drift, not an actual climate event. Don't panic and don't touch the vents manually. First, restart the calibration daemon and give it ten minutes to re-baseline. If readings still disagree by more than 5%, flip the controller into safe mode. The safe-mode thresholds it will use are these.

config for yahap-bajof:
[istix]
host = istix.qorvelsys.internal
user = istix_svc
database = istix_prod

The static-analysis baseline file for Mosswick is regenerated each sprint and attached to the release ticket. Support should never edit it by hand; a mismatched baseline makes the scanner flag every file. Before the baseline is accepted by CI, it must be signed so tampering is detectable. Verification during triage uses the public half of the key listed below.

deploy key for kafof-kaguf: bky9_WnPyu8S2E